摘要
Benefiting from a proposed distorted octahedral site occupation strategy using Cr 3+ , we demonstraed a high-efficiency broadband NIR-emitting phosphor LiScGe 2 O 6 :Cr 3+ peaking at 886 nm with a full width at half maximum of 160 nm and a record external quantum efficiency of ∼40%.
